Ingredients (adapted from my I Love Trader Joe's cookbook):
- 3 c. cooked rice (I used brown, gave it a nice crunch)
- 2 tbsp. Earth Balance butter
- 1 medium onion, diced
- 1 c. diced celery
- 1/2 c. dried montmorency tart cherries
- 1 tsp. dried thyme
- Salt & pepper
- Melt butter in large skillet
- Saute onion, celery, cherries, and thyme until softened
- Stir in cooked rice
- Season with salt & pepper
Super easy and super tasty. I doubled the recipe for the six adults and 2 kids and we had plenty left over (the leftovers were really good, too). The original recipe called for 1/2 c. chopped walnuts, but I left those out. I didn't really miss them, either. The brown rice added a nice texture that you just don't get with white rice.
